Berala Railway Station (RAILWAY STATION), NSW Details
Description
A railway station on the City-Bankstown-Lidcombe line about 17km from Central Railway Station.
Origin
BERALA Opened 11/11/1912 The Construction names were Bareela Sidmouth & Torrington. Berala is Aboriginal word meaning Musk duck.
